May 2025 - Apr 2026Coed Yr Esgob area has the 12th lowest crime rate of 25 local areas in Llantrisant and Talbot Green , and the 238th lowest crime rate of 791 local areas in Rhondda Cynon Taf .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Coed Yr Esgob (CF72 8EL) in the last 12 months was 39.0 per 1,000 residents and was 60.1% lower than the Llantrisant and Talbot Green average (97.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 5 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 9 (≈ 31.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 12.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-51.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Coed Yr Esgob (CF72 8EL), the main crime hotspot is near George Street. Police recorded 20 crimes here, including 9 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
